I am trying to build a popup that will work for both a Web Map in a browser as well as Field Maps.

I can build part of the with regular HTML Formatting with the fields that come from the layer the popup is based with (this are the fields with the Green Headings).

The issue is with the section with the Orange Heading.  This is an arcade field (highlighted yellow) that contains a relate and builds an entire HTML based table from the main layer to another table in the map (lower right part part of first screenshot using FeatureSetByName).

The good news is that everything works in Field Maps (and Pro for that matter) as you can see in the first screenshot.

The problem is that the results of the Arcade field are displayed as raw HTML in the popup in the Web Browser. 

Is there any way for the HTML coming from Arcade to be displayed as a table when looking at it it in a browser? 

Will Field Maps and Pro continue to work the way it does now?

AnneFitz
Esri Regular Contributor

@GregDunnigan - you could also try authoring your Arcade expression via the Arcade popup content element. Here's a blog that explains how it's done: https://www.esri.com/arcgis-blog/products/arcgis-online/mapping/part-1-introducing-arcade-pop-up-con...

This solution should work in Field Maps and Pro 3.0.
